Institute of Clinical Laboratory Sciences (ICLS) produced forty-one (41) newly licensed Medical Technologists during the August 2024 Medical Technologists Licensure Examination
The Silliman University (SU) Institute of Clinical Laboratory Sciences (ICLS) produced forty-one (41) newly licensed Medical Technologists during the August 2024 Medical Technologists Licensure Examination! According to the Professional Regulation Commission (PRC), 3,872 out of 5,574 passed the Medical Technologists Licensure Examination. The National Passing Rate was 69.47%. Meanwhile, SU garnered an 85.42% overall performance […]

SU Biology hosts US students for International Research Program
The Silliman University (SU) College of Arts and Sciences – Biology Department welcomed five (5) undergraduate students from the United States for its third cycle of the Philippines International Research Experience for Students (Ph-IRES) program from June 17 to July 31, 2024. Supported by the United States National Science Foundation, the annual initiative aims to […]

No classes in all levels and all SU offices will be closed on August 21 and 26, 2024
No classes in all levels and all SU offices will be closed on August 21 and 26, 2024. Pursuant to Proclamation No. 368, August 21 is Ninoy Aquino Day, a special non-working holiday while August 26 is National Heroes Day, a regular holiday. Classes and operations will resume the day after each date.
